#42f1b8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#42f1b8 is composed of 25.9% red, 94.5%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.7%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 160.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 60.2%. #42f1b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#84ffff with #00e371.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#42f1b8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#42f1b8 has RGB values of R:66, G:241,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 4387256.

Hex triplet 42f1b8 #42f1b8
RGB Decimal 66, 241, 184 rgb(66,241,184)
RGB Percent 25.9, 94.5, 72.2 rgb(25.9%,94.5%,72.2%)
CMYK 73, 0, 24, 5
HSL 160.5°, 86.2, 60.2 hsl(160.5,86.2%,60.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 160.5°, 72.6, 94.5
Web Safe 33ffcc #33ffcc
CIE-LAB 85.769, -56.764, 15.083
XYZ 42.35, 67.525, 56.147
xyY 0.255, 0.407, 67.525
CIE-LCH 85.769, 58.733, 165.12
CIE-LUV 85.769, -66.234, 31.563
Hunter-Lab 82.174, -51.81, 17.011
Binary 01000010, 11110001, 10111000
